About The Role

We are working on Project Astra, which is NetApp's new offering delivering end-to-end application data lifecycle management for cloud native applications hosted on Kubernetes clusters. Astra Control Center is a self-managed on-premise software solution that enables data protection, disaster recovery, and migration for on-premise Kubernetes workloads leveraging NetApp's industry-leading data management technology for snapshots, backups, replication, and cloning. Astra Control Center can optionally be connected to the NetApp Cloud Services for advanced monitoring and insights .
